Hold a clean, sterile gauze pad by a corner and … WebFeb 24, 2024 · If the wound, cut, or scrape has foreign bodies like debris or dirt in it – try to remove them using irrigation. Again, irrigate with clean water, a mild soap, or a saline solution. If that doesn’t dislodge them, use tweezers that you have sterilized with an antiseptic like rubbing alcohol. WebJun 3, 2024 · Instead of reaching for hydrogen peroxide, wash your wound with clean water. You can also use a gentle saline solution, if you have one. 2. Add an ointment. Blood helps clean wounds, so a little bleeding is good. Most small cuts and scrapes stop bleeding pretty quickly, but you can help by applying firm, gentle pressure with gauze or a tissue ...

WebSoap may irritate the cut, so try to stick with just water. Washing the injury greatly reduces the risk of infection but also helps in removing any dirt or debris that may have been lodged. WebJan 28, 2024 · Put a gauze bandage, a towel, or similar cloth material over the cut and apply pressure until the bleeding stops. Elevating the finger will help, as well. If the person with the cut feels weak or dizzy, call 911 and treat for shock. It's always better to be safe than sorry, but it's still probably not life-threatening.

WebProper care of wounds can prevent infection and speed up the body’s healing process. Treatment Immediately after the injury, wash thoroughly with clean water and mild soap. Remove any visible dirt or debris from the wound. Apply gentle pressure to stop bleeding.
